Background
Pilch, Herbert Leo was born on February 13, 1927 in Wehlau, Federal Republic of Germany. Son of Leo Kurt Karl and Dorotea Wilhelmine (Schinz) Pilch.

Doctor of Philosophy, University Kiel, Federal Republic of Germany, 1951. Diploma in teaching, University Kiel, Federal Republic of Germany, 1952. Venia legendi, University Kiel, Federal Republic of Germany, 1957.
Doctor of Letters (honorary), University St. Andrews, 1984. Doctor (honorary), University Iasi, Romania, 1993.
Instructor University Kiel, 1952-1953, lecturer, 1957-1959. Deputy professor University Cologne, Federal Republic of Germany, 1959-1960. Associate professor University Frankfurt am Main, Germany, 1960-1961.
Full professor English language University Freiburg, Germany, since 1961. Research fellow Yale University, New Haven, 1953-1954. Visiting professor Monash University, Clayton, Victoria, Australia, 1969, Lomonosov-U. Moscow, 1976, University Massachusetts, Amherst, 1977-1978, University Lower Brittany, Brest, France, 1986, 89-90.
Chairman Democratic Ecology Party, Baden-Wüttemberg, 1986-1988. Chairman Indiana Ecologists of Germany, since 1993. Fellow International Society Phonetic Sciences.
Member World Linguistic Circle (executive committee since 1978), European Society Linguistics (president 1990-1991), Society Functional Linguistics, German Science Foundation (senator 1964-1970).
Married Annegret Harms, November 7, 1959. Children: Hartmut, Gudrun.
